Cisco and the City of Stockholm are pleased to invite you to the Public Services Summit 2008 to be held once again in Stockholm, Sweden beginning on Monday, 8 December. Stockholm, the city where dialogue is easy, has been the host city for the event for the past seven years. The Summit will conclude in Oslo, Norway on Thursday, 11 December. The event coincides with the Nobel Prize festivities that take place in these cities during this time period.

This unique, invitation-only event offers you the opportunity to discover how to unlock new sources of public value and deliver services in innovative and more sustainable ways.
